What are Aluminium Storm Doors?
Aluminium storm doors are a protective barrier installed in front of an exterior door, normally created to stand up to severe climate condition. Unlike traditional wooden doors, aluminium doors are made from light-weight, durable alloy that is resistant to rust, rust, and warping.

Advantages of Aluminium Storm Doors
1. Toughness and Longevity
Aluminium storm doors are extremely durable and can withstand different weather conditions without contorting or deteriorating. This makes them an excellent investment for house owners who desire a long-lasting option.
2. Energy Efficiency
Aluminium storm doors supply an extra layer of insulation, helping to keep your home comfy year-round. Numerous models are designed with thermal breaks, which help to decrease heat transfer, causing lower energy costs.
3. website Low Maintenance
Unlike wood doors that need regular painting and sealing, aluminium storm doors are reasonably low maintenance. A basic wash with soap and water is typically enough to maintain their look.
4. Security Features
Many aluminium storm doors come geared up with robust locking systems and enhanced frames, enhancing the security of your home versus intruders.
5. Visual Appeal
Aluminium storm doors are available in different designs, colors, and finishes. This enables homeowners to choose a door that matches their existing architecture and improves curb appeal.
6. Adaptability
These doors can be fitted with different kinds of glass, consisting of tempered glass for added strength, or with screens that can be quickly interchanged, providing flexibility for both summer and winter seasons.
How to Choose the Right Aluminium Storm Door
Design and Design: Consider the architectural style of your home. Do you choose a modern-day, sleek appearance or a more conventional door style?
Glass Options: Decide whether you want clear glass for unobstructed views or ornamental glass for added personal privacy and design.
Screen Options: Consider whether the door will be used primarily in warmer months. Some models feature interchangeable screens for ventilation.
Color and Finish: Aluminium doors are available in numerous colors and finishes. Select one that matches your home's existing color scheme.
Size and Fit: Measure your door frame precisely. While lots of aluminium storm doors are standard sizes, personalization options are also readily available.

Maintenance Tips for Aluminium Storm Doors
Keeping an aluminium storm door is relatively uncomplicated, but it's important to follow these actions for maximum longevity:
Cleaning: Wash the door with soap and water a minimum of twice a year to eliminate dirt and gunk.
Examination: Check hinges and locking mechanisms for signs of wear and tear. Oil them as essential.
Weather Stripping: Inspect the weather condition removing for damage and replace it if needed to keep energy performance.
Paint Touch-Ups: If the paint begins to chip or peel, touch it up without delay to prevent rust.
Inspect Screens: If your door has a screen, check it for tears or holes and repair work or change as needed.
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: Are aluminium storm doors actually energy-efficient?
A1: Yes, aluminium storm doors can significantly enhance your home's energy performance by providing an extra layer of insulation, which helps in reducing heating and cooling costs.
Q2: How long do aluminium storm doors last?
A2: With appropriate upkeep, aluminium storm doors can last 30 years or more, making them a wise investment for property owners.
Q3: Can I install an aluminium storm door myself?
A3: While some useful homeowners may select to install their doors, working with a professional can ensure an appropriate fit and optimum efficiency.
Q4: Are aluminium storm doors expensive?
A4: The cost of aluminium storm doors can vary extensively based upon customization options, but they are usually considered an affordable alternative compared to wood doors.
Q5: Do they feature warranties?
A5: Most producers provide service warranties varying from 1 to 10 years, depending on the door's functions and products.
